10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Montecarlo

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by vehicle type and features. Whether you're looking for an SUV for added space, a convertible for summer drives, or an economy car for budget-friendly options,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the perfect vehicle for your trip.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ates can vary based on demand, so it's advisable to book your car well ahead of your travel date. By reserving in advance, you’re more likely to secure lower prices and enjoy better availability, particularly during peak travel se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Compact cars are typically more affordable to rent and easier to maneuver and park in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als strike a good balance between price,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ain vehicle types—such as SUVs or premium models—might not be available. Renters over 70 years old may also face similar restrictions. Always verify the age requirements before making a re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ate under a full-to-full fuel policy, which requires you to return the car with a full tank to avoid additional fees. This is generally the most economical choice. Other options may include full-to-empty or prepaid fueling, which can also be convenient. Just remember to return the car empty in that case.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: There is often a surcharge for picking up your rental car at airports, but the convenience may justify the extra cost.
  7. Know your payment options: Most car rental companies accept only cred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provide peace of mind in case something unforeseen occurs during your trip. Adding car rental insurance when booking through Expedia is straightforward.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you plan to take long road trips, seek out r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ent incurring extra char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a car.

Can I drive in Montecarlo with my current driver's license?
If you don't possess a driver's license issued in Italy, then you might need to acquire an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your place of residence in order to rent a car. It's also important to note that if you do need an IDP, it won't be valid on its own. You'll be asked to show your driver's license from your home country your passport and other forms of identification as well. Lastly, make sure the credit card you used to book the rental matches the name on your license and passport. A few other things to note for international car rentals are:
  • Age restrictions: You need to be 25 or older in most places to rent a car. If you're younger than that, it may still be possible to rent a car but you'll have to pay a Young Driver's Surcharge. Additional restrictions may also apply to the types of cars you can rent.
  • Driving limitations: Be sure to read the fine print before sliding behind the wheel. You typically can't cross country borders, drive onto ferries or on certain types of rugged terrain with a rental car.
